Why Choose Stainless Steel?
Before diving into technique, it helps to understand why stainless steel is worth learning. Unlike non-stick pans that need replacing every few years, a quality stainless steel pan can last a lifetime. The cooking surface is virtually indestructible—you can use metal utensils, scrub vigorously, and subject it to high heat without worry.
More importantly, stainless steel excels at things non-stick cannot do. It achieves the Maillard reaction—the chemical process that creates deep browning and complex flavours on seared meats and vegetables. It allows you to develop fond, those caramelised bits on the pan bottom that form the foundation of rich pan sauces.

Understanding Stainless Steel Construction
Not all stainless steel cookware is created equal. Understanding basic construction helps you make informed purchasing decisions and explains why some pans perform better than others.
The Problem with Plain Stainless Steel
Stainless steel alone is a poor heat conductor. A pan made entirely of stainless steel would have severe hot spots—areas directly over the flame would overheat while other areas remained cool. This leads to uneven cooking and burning.
The Multi-Ply Solution
Quality stainless steel cookware solves this problem with layered (or "clad") construction. A core of highly conductive metal—usually aluminium or copper—is sandwiched between layers of stainless steel. The conductive core spreads heat evenly, while the stainless steel provides a durable, non-reactive cooking surface.
You'll see this described as "3-ply," "5-ply," or similar terms. These numbers refer to the total layers of metal. A 3-ply pan has three layers (stainless steel, aluminium, stainless steel), while a 5-ply pan has five alternating layers for even better heat distribution.
Fully-Clad vs. Disc-Bottom
Fully-clad pans have layers extending up the sides, providing even heating throughout. Disc-bottom pans only have the conductive core in the base. For frying pans, fully-clad construction is preferable as heat distribution up the sides matters for many cooking techniques.
Choosing Your First Stainless Steel Pan
For beginners, we recommend starting with a single, versatile pan rather than a complete set. A 26-28cm frying pan (also called a skillet) handles the widest range of cooking tasks and teaches fundamental stainless steel techniques.
What to Look For
- Multi-ply construction: Look for at least 3-ply with an aluminium core
- Comfortable handle: Should stay cool and feel balanced when the pan is empty and full
- Appropriate weight: Heavy enough for stability, light enough to manoeuvre
- Induction compatibility: Essential if you have an induction cooktop
- Oven-safe rating: At least 200°C (400°F) for versatility

Essential Techniques for Success
Stainless steel cooking has a learning curve, but it's shorter than most people think. Master these fundamental techniques, and you'll achieve excellent results from day one.
The Preheating Ritual
Proper preheating is the single most important skill for stainless steel cooking. Here's the process:
- Place your empty, dry pan over medium heat
- Wait 2-3 minutes for the pan to heat thoroughly
- Test by sprinkling a few water droplets onto the surface
- When water forms a single ball that dances across the pan, you're ready
- Add oil and let it heat for 30 seconds until shimmering
This water test is called the Leidenfrost effect. It indicates that the pan is hot enough for the metal pores to close, creating a naturally non-stick surface.
Managing Heat
Unlike non-stick, which often requires high heat, stainless steel works best at medium temperatures. High heat is only necessary for quick searing. For most cooking, medium to medium-high provides optimal results without burning oil or food.
Stainless steel retains heat well, so it doesn't need as much energy input as you might expect. Start lower than you think necessary—you can always increase heat if needed.
Using Enough Oil
Oil creates a barrier between food and metal. Use 1-2 tablespoons for a standard frying pan, ensuring the entire cooking surface is coated. Don't worry about excess oil—much of it stays in the pan rather than being absorbed by food.
The Patience Principle
When food first contacts hot stainless steel, it bonds to the surface. This is normal. As cooking continues, the food develops a crust and naturally releases. Trying to move food before this happens tears the surface and causes sticking.
Wait until food releases easily before flipping. Gently test by sliding a spatula underneath—if it resists, give it more time.
Your First Stainless Steel Meal
Start with something forgiving: sautéed vegetables or chicken thighs. These foods are relatively tolerant of timing variations and help you learn heat management without high stakes.
Beginner-Friendly: Sautéed Vegetables
- Preheat your pan over medium heat for 2-3 minutes
- Add 2 tablespoons of oil and let it shimmer
- Add vegetables in a single layer (don't crowd)
- Let them sit undisturbed for 2-3 minutes until golden underneath
- Stir and repeat until cooked to your preference
- Season and serve
Notice how the vegetables release naturally once they've developed colour? That's the magic of proper stainless steel technique.
Beginner Tip
If food sticks badly, your pan likely wasn't hot enough or you moved the food too soon. Clean up, start over, and try again with a hotter pan and more patience.
Cleaning and Care
One advantage of stainless steel is its resilience. You can clean it more aggressively than non-stick without causing damage.
Regular Cleaning
For normal cooking residue, warm soapy water and a non-abrasive sponge work well. Wash while the pan is still slightly warm (not hot) for easiest cleaning.
Stuck-On Food
For stubborn bits, fill the pan with water and bring to a simmer. The heat loosens residue, which can then be scraped away with a wooden spoon. Empty and wash normally.
Discolouration and Stains
Rainbow discolouration and white spots are normal and don't affect cooking performance. To remove them for aesthetic reasons, use Bar Keeper's Friend or a paste of baking soda and water. Scrub gently, rinse, and dry.
What to Avoid
- Don't leave acidic foods in the pan for extended periods
- Don't use bleach or chlorine-based cleaners
- Avoid thermal shock (don't plunge a hot pan into cold water)

Common Beginner Questions
Is the rainbow discolouration normal?
Yes. This is caused by heat and is purely cosmetic. It doesn't affect cooking performance and can be removed with Bar Keeper's Friend if desired.
Why does my food stick?
Usually because the pan wasn't hot enough, there wasn't enough oil, or you tried to move the food too soon. Review the preheating and patience sections above.
Can I use metal utensils?
Yes. Unlike non-stick, stainless steel can handle metal spatulas, spoons, and whisks without damage.
Is stainless steel safe?
Extremely safe. Stainless steel is non-reactive, doesn't release chemicals at high temperatures, and is used in hospitals and food processing for its hygienic properties.
